Indulge in the Luxurious Layers of Chocolate Cherry Dream Cake
Save
Imagine a breakfast that feels like a celebration—soft, buttery cake layers infused with dark chocolate, punctuated by bright, tart cherry ribbons, and finished with a silky ganache that glistens like sunrise. This is the Chocolate Cherry Dream Cake, a brunch centerpiece that turns ordinary mornings into indulgent moments.
What makes this cake truly luxurious is the harmony between rich cocoa and the natural sweetness of ripe cherries, layered with a light vanilla‑kissed sponge that never feels heavy. The secret lies in a simple yet precise technique: each layer is brushed with cherry‑syrup before being stacked, ensuring every bite is moist and bursting with flavor.
Family gatherings, lazy weekend brunches, or a special birthday toast—any occasion that calls for a little decadence will love this cake. It’s perfect for those who crave a dessert‑style breakfast without the guilt of over‑richness.
The process starts with preparing three cake layers, then whipping a quick cherry compote, followed by a glossy chocolate ganache. A final dusting of cocoa powder and fresh cherries completes the masterpiece, ready to wow your guests within an hour.

Preparing the Cake Batter
Begin by preheating the oven to 350°F (175°C) and greasing three 8‑inch round cake pans. In a large bowl whisk together flour, cocoa powder, baking powder, and salt. In a separate bowl, cream softened butter with sugar until pale and fluffy—about 3 minutes on medium speed. This aerates the batter, giving the cake a tender crumb.
